Patch de Atualização do TelEduc v3.1.6 para v3.1.7 ================================================== ================================================================================ OBSERVAÇÕES: 1) Leia atentamente todo o documento, antes de iniciar a aplicação do patch. 2) Se desejar manter cópia dos arquivos anteriores, deverá fazer backup dos mesmos antes de instalar o patch. 3) Se você realizou alterações no código do ambiente, verifique se os arquivos que serão substituidos não sobreescreverão os que foram modificados. 4) A lista de arquivos contidos neste patch pode ser obtida do arquivo 'ListaArquivos.txt' 5) Atente para mensagens exibidas durante o processo de aplicação do patch. ================================================================================ 1. [[ CORREÇÕES ]] Este patch visa corrigir os seguintes erros: - Erro no recurso 'Avaliar requisições para abertura de cursos' ('Administração'); - Erro no recurso 'Estatísticas do Ambiente' ('Administração'); - Erro na anexação de foto na ferramenta Perfil; - Acesso de alunos a cursos ainda não iniciados; - Frase no e-mail de notificação de inscrição aceita; - Frase no e-mail enviado ao se inscrever alunos/formadores e ao alterar o tipo de usuário (aluno <=> formador); - Remetente do e-mail de notificações de novidades e da cópia das mensagens da ferramenta Correio; - Erro no envio de cópia das mensagens da ferramenta Correio para múltiplos destinatários; - Expansão de caracteres curingas (wildcards) nas mensagens da ferramenta Bate-papo pelo shell do servidor; - Erro ao tentar entrar na sala de Bate-papo se o apelido contiver um caractere de apóstrofo. - Frases ausentes em inglês e espanhol para o recurso 'Reutilização de Cursos'. - Frase cadastrada em português no código-fonte do recurso 'Reutilização de Cursos'. 2. [[ INSTALAÇÃO ]] 2.1 - Para instalação do Patch, descompacte o arquivo .tar.gz baixado no diretório base do teleduc (em geral, /home/teleduc/public_html): $ cd /home/teleduc/public_html $ tar -xvzf patch-teleduc-v3.1.7.tar.gz 2.2 - Execute o script aplicar_patch.sh: $ cd patch-v3.1.7/ $ ./aplicar_patch.sh 2.3 - Se após execução do script 'aplicar_patch.sh' for exibida a mensagem: -bash: ./aplicar_patch.sh: /bin/bash: bad interpreter: No such file or directory será necessário editar o arquivo 'aplicar_patch.sh' alterando a primeira linha do arquivo para o caminho correto de seu shell. Por padrão utilizamos o shell 'bash' (Bourne Again SHell). Para listar os shell's disponíveis em seu sistema digite o comando: $ chsh -list A primeira linha do arquivo 'aplicar_patch.sh' contém a seguinte estrutura: #!CAMINHO_DO_SHELL No exemplo padrão: #!/bin/bash 2.4 - Concluída a aplicação do patch, através de um browser, entre na administração do ambiente TelEduc. O mesmo deverá exibir a mensagem confirmando o sucesso na instalação do Patch. 2.5 - Tendo maiores problemas, entre em contato através do e-mail .